LARGE HOME PRODUCTION TIME FRAMES
4,000 – 6,000 SF
14 – 18 months
6,000 – 8,000 SF
18 – 22 months
8,000 – 10,000 SF
22+ months
Add 1 month to the production schedule for each option desired below:
- Basement finish
- Pool
- Secondary Structure

Customer alignment
3 Meetings

Through our customer alignment process, we are able to set and maintain reasonable expectations. During this time, multiple important factors are finalized, such as:
- Lot/location to build the home
- Floor plan (we’ll help with this!)
- Budget for the new home
This process is divided into three to four different meetings for maximum efficiency. After these meetings, you’ll have everything you need to decide whether you’d like to move forward with building your custom home! From here, you’ll sign an Intent to Build agreement and submit a $22,000.00 non-refundable deposit that will count toward your contract deposit.

Schematic Floor Plan Design – 5 weeks
- 5 in-person or virtual meetings
- Provide weekly budget ranges
- Prepare for soft plan approval
- Schematic = Pre-engineering
Sign Sales Docs/Contracts – 2 weeks
- Sign digitally via DotLoop
- Collect contract deposit
- Submit contracts for loan approval
- Submit plans for “Arc” Approval
Schematic Pricing – 3 weeks
- 1 – 2 in person or virtual meetings
- Prepare professional quote for home
- Schematic = Pre-engineering
Engineering – 4 weeks
- 2nd RND. of engineering
- Stake final location of home on lot
- Timeline dependent on engineer
Finish Selections – 7 weeks
Requires significant time commitment
- 7 in person or virtual meetings
- Collect engineering & survey deposit
- 1st RND. Engineering & surveying
- Selection house meetings
- Approve or decline all selections
- Feedback on structural allowances
City Permitting – 4 – 6 weeks
- All cities have unique plan review processes
- Hand off to production team
- Schedule ground breaking ceremony

Ground Breaking Milestone
WHEN: Before excavation
WHERE: On site
WHO: CCH team, Owners, Realtors, Friends, Invitation to all!
Production Intro Milestone
WHEN: After Ground Breaking
WHERE: CCH Office
WHO: CCH Production team, Interior Designer & Owners
Foundation Milestone
WHEN: Before Framing Start
WHERE: CCH Office
WHO: Director of Ops, Rough-in PM, & Owners
Framing Milestone
WHEN: Framing Completion
WHERE: On site
WHO: Director of Ops, Rough-in PM, & Owners
Electrical Milestone
WHEN: Before Electrical Rough
WHERE: On site
WHO: Rough-in PM, Finish PM, Interior Designer, Owners
Flatwork Milestone
WHEN: During Insulation/Drywall
WHERE: On site
WHO: Director of Ops, Rough-in PM, Finish PM, & Owners
Trim & Tile Milestone
WHEN: After Drywall
WHERE: On site
WHO: Director of Ops, Finish PM, Interior Designer, & Owners
Paint Milestone
WHEN: After Tile Install
WHERE: On site
WHO: Finish PM, Interior Designer, & Owners
Close Out Milestone
WHEN: Approx. 2 months to closing
WHERE: CCH Office
WHO: Director of Ops, Finish PM, Closing PM & Owners
Punch List Milestone
WHEN: Substantial Completion
WHERE: On site
WHO: CCH Team Only
Move-In Date Milestone
WHEN: After CCH Punch
WHERE: On site
WHO: Director of Ops, Closing PM, & Owners
